Raymond Wahlert, President & Chief Executive Officer (CEO)

Ray has served Pacific since 1979.  In 1981, he was promoted to Branch Manager, and became President and CEO in 2003.  Ray was appointed to Pacific’s Board of Directors in 1996 and now serves as Chairman of the Board.

His past community involvement includes:  Nampa Housing Authority Chairman of the Board of Commissioners; Hope House Board of Directors; Nampa Idaho Chamber of Commerce member and Nampa Rotary Club member.  He also served on Advisory Committees for Vallivue High School FAA, Nampa High School Welding Club, Rotary Club Member and Boys Scouts of America (Troop 116).

Ray currently serves as:  University of Great Falls Trustee; Airport Authority Board Director; NeighborWorks Advisory Committee member; and First Vice President Montana Council Boy Scouts of America.

Ray graduated from Portland State University with an M.B.A. in Economics.  He has completed courses in Performance Management, Effective Sales Management, Steel Service Center Management, Effective Speaking, and Human Relations and Leadership training.  He served in the U.S. Army from 1967-1970 and was stationed in Vietnam and Germany.  Ray and his wife Lynne have three children.

Bill Knick, Executive Vice President


Bill Knick began his career at Pacific Steel & Recycling in 1974 as a Recycling Warehouse Manager Trainee.  His Pacific career progressed to include:  Recycling Manager of Operations in Helena, MT; Branch Manager in Miles City, MT; Branch Manager in Pocatello, ID’s recycling branch; and Corporate Vice President in Great Falls, MT. He was promoted to Corporate Executive Vice President in October, 2007.
 
His past community involvement includes: Gate City Rotary Club President (Pocatello, ID); Pocatello Regional Development Authority Board of Directors; Great Falls Rotary Club Board Member; High Plains Development Authority Board of Directors (Great Falls, MT); and Great Falls Development Authority Chairman of the Board.
 
Bill started his college education at Dawson County Community College, transferring to Eastern Montana College, culminating with a B.A. in Finance from the University of Montana in 1974.  Bill and his wife Cherrie have three children.

Ed Leppien, Vice President – Steel Operations

Ed began his career with Montana Steel Company as a steel fabricator in Billings, MT.  In 1978 he joined Pacific as a salesperson at the Billings steel branch, becoming manager in 1985.  In 1993, he was promoted to Vice President of the Steel Service Center Division at the corporate offices in Great Falls, MT.
 
Ed has served on Pacific’s Board of Directors since 1991. In addition, he currently volunteers for the Great Falls Chamber of Commerce Board of Directors; the Great Falls Development Authority; and the Paris Gibson Square Museum of Art.  Ed is also a member of the Uptown Optimist Club.
 
Ed graduated from Montana State University with a B.S. in Business Management.  He is married.

Jeff Millhollin, Vice President of Operations

Jeff Millhollin began his career at Pacific Steel & Recycling in 1996 as the Assistant Operations Manager.  He was promoted to Regional Manager of  the Boise/Nampa, Idaho, branch in 2001, and accepted the position of Vice President of Operations in 2007.  His previous employment includes scale operator and scrap buyer/marketing, and general manager at Richmond Steel Recycling in Canada.

His community involvement includes:  Association of Idaho Recyclers Board of Directors and Treasurer; British Columbia Chapter of the Canadian Association of Recycling Industries President; Northern California Chapter of the Institute of Scrap Recycling Industry committee member; Executive Leadership Exchange member in Nampa, Idaho; and service with many other community volunteer organizations.
 
Jeff is a 2003 graduate of Northwest Nazarene University with B.S. in Business Management.  He and his wife have two children.

Bob Short, Vice President

Having served as Pacific’s Human Resources Director for over 20 years, Bob was recently promoted to Vice President.  He has been with Pacific since 1978, and was previously employed by Buttrey Foods and Burlington Northern Railroad.
 
His community involvement includes:  West Side Federal Credit Union President of the Board of Directors; Great Falls Chapter of the Society of Human Resource Management (SHRM) President of the Board of Directors; Montana State Insurance Fund Board of Directors; Cascade County Zoning Board Commission member; Monarch/Neihart Quick Response Union member; Monarch Volunteer Fire Department member.  Bob currently serves as Patrol Director for the National Ski Patrol.
 
Bob graduated from the University of Great Falls with a B.S. in Business Administration and a minor in Accounting and Economics. In addition to his formal education, he served in the United States Army and was a Pathfinder Team Leader in Vietnam. Bob and his wife have two children.

Tim Culliton, Chief Financial Officer (CFO)

A 1976 graduate of Carroll College with a degree in accounting and economics, Tim began his career with Pacific Steel & Recycling in 2000.  Previously he was the Audit Manager at JCCS, Controller at Bison Motor Company, and Controller at Energy West.
 
His past community involvement includes:  Montana Diabetes Association President and Treasurer, numerous positions with the United Way of Cascade County, Great Falls Food Bank Treasurer, High Plains Development Authority Treasurer.  Tim currently serves as President of the Benefis Foundation Board of Directors, and is on the Loan Review Committee of the Great Falls Development Authority.
 
Tim and his wife have two children.

Dave Richards, Chief Information Officer (CIO)


Dave has been with Pacific Steel & Recycling for 26 years.  He previously served as Pacific’s treasurer, and as project manager of our accounting software package implementation.
 
Dave is the immediate past president of Quest International Users Group. He has been a member of the Quest Board of Directors since 2002, previously serving as executive vice president, treasurer, director of conferences and director of vendor relations.  He currently serves on the Meadowlark Country Club Board.
 
Dave, a CPA, graduated from Montana State University with a B.A. in Accounting.  He and his wife have two children.

Jayne Merrill, Human Resources Manager


Jayne began her career in the industrial rubber goods division of Chardon Rubber and continued at National-Standard Company and Textron Fastening Systems.  She has served as a human resources manager since 1984. Jayne joined Pacific Steel & Recycling in 2006.
 
Jayne has a professional membership with the Society of Human Resource Management.  She volunteers as emcee, musician and singer for numerous community functions.
 
Jayne became certified as a Professional in Human Resources in 1993 and graduated from the University of Phoenix with a B.S.  in Business Management.
